I have a 92 190E2.6 that has had very mild stumble/rough idle. Other than that, the car runs very strong. Plugs are new and this started at 60k and the car now has 75k miles. I scoped the secondary and cylinder #1 had an erratic waveform. Pulled injector #1 out and placed in a cup with engine at idle. the injector spray was just a single stream and went to an offsided spray once rpms above 2000. What is the average life for mechanical injectors? These are the brass injectors with the tips being steel. Should all the injectors be changed at the same time to keep uniformity in all cylinders. This injection nozzle sounds faulty and you can bet that the rest are right behind. I usually do replace them in sets for good measure. Some techs have a different opinion, but you know what they say about opinions...
